Scott Landes was quoted in the California News-Times article “California COVID vaccine mandate extends to aides for people with disabilities.”

Studies show that people with intellectual or developmental disabilities often have an underlying health condition. Make them more sensitive Accomplice.

“And when they are diagnosed with covid-19, they are about two to three times more likely to die of the disease,” he said. Scott Landes, Associate Professor of Sociology, Faculty of Citizenship and Public Relations, Syracuse University.

Landes said The case seems to depend on two variables: The amount of face-to-face intimate care required by existing conditions and people with developmental disabilities.

“This really makes sense for covid,” he said. “If you have a caregiver right next to you all day long, it will increase your chances of getting sick.”
